Sadly we have been called to stand in Honor for Julius N. Toth, SGT US Army WW II 1941 – 1946.
Julius was assigned to the 6837th Guardhouse Overhead Detachment as a Mechanic, Auto Wheel Vehicle (Third Echelon).
Significant awards include American Defense Service Medal, American Theater Campaign Ribbon, European-African-Middle Eastern Theater Campaign Ribbon, Goosd Conduct Medal, World War II Victory Medal.
